Scotland have confirmed that they will not be taking the knee before their Euro 2020 matches but Steve Clarke's players will continue to promote an anti-racism message ahead of kick-off. Their statement read: "The Scotland Men’s National Team will continue to take a stand against racism prior to kick-off for all UEFA EURO 2020 matches. The Scotland players will instead be standing while the Three Lions kneel ahead of kick-off, as both teams show their support for the fight against racism in contrasting ways. In an open letter to England supporters, Southgate has outlined the reasons he feels it is necessary to continue taking the knee.
